Business Structure in Lihue

In opening a business in Lihue, there are several available business structures that you will want to know about. Sole Proprietorships, Partnerships, Corporations and LLC's are among the options. Each of these business structures has its own advantages and disadvantages in Lihue, and determining which structure is right for your business can be challenging.
